Carl Hames Nominated President Of Chamber Ambassadors Council

  • Wednesday, June 17, 2020

Carlos Hames, workspace consultant at Office Furniture Warehouse, has been nominated president of the Chattanooga Area Chamber of Commerce Ambassadors Program - a Chamber board position. 

Mr. Hames has a long record of service to his community via the Chattanooga Area Chamber of Commerce, serving on various councils and capacities throughout the Chamber's effort in economic development. In addition to his new appointments, he also serves as treasurer of the Chamber’s East Ridge Council.

As president of the Ambassadors Council, he will work closely with and listen to other Ambassador board members to grow Ambassador membership and be a positive steward when representing the Chamber to both Chamber members and potential members in the community.

As a board member, he will try to do his part to ensure the continuation and advancement of the Chattanooga Chamber’s efforts within the community.

“It has been a privilege and a joy to be associated with the Chattanooga Chamber," said Mr. Hames. "Whether it’s serving on a board, attending meetings or delivering food during the pandemic, I feel like my association with this organization has made me a better overall Chattanoogan. I look forward to the great things that are going to happen in the future."
